Literature: an illustrated Weekly Magazine, Volume 1, Number 20, July 7, 1888

One of 3 issues in the title: Literature: an illustrated Weekly Magazine available on this site.

Description

Weekly literary magazine that contains articles and excerpts on various topics as well as advertisements; according the to the cover, it includes "Criticism, Biography, News, [and] Selected Readings." Contents for this issue: Maurice Thompson at Home, Selections from A Fortnight of Folly, and Sylvan Secrets in Bird-Songs and Books.
